heres the machine im trying to fix/diagnose

300w psu (is it enough wattage??)
athlonxp 1800+
gigabtye 7vm400m-rz mobo
512megs pc2700 (2x256)
dvd-rom drive (ide)
cd-rw 24x12x52 (ide)
no harddrive yet (still having problems just using live linux CD)

here are the symptoms:

turns off after an amount of time (kind of random, sometimes it turns off after half an hour, some times it turns off during boot)

to me, it sounded like a cooling problem, but i checked the temps, and they look fine.

shows no errors in memtest86 live up until it turns off.

it looks like the processor (which is used) got so hot that the text on it got burned into the heat sink. here's a picture: here's a picture of the processor and heat sink

it looks like there may be burn marks on it ... you'll see them :p

could this be the cause of my problems?


maybe i just dont have enough power?

any help i would appreciate. thanks.
 
Next time the computer shuts down on its own, try to restart it right away. If it restarts right away then it is probley not an overheating problem. Your powersupply may also be the issue alot of motherboards require atleast 350watts. Also make sure that it has a p4(i think) connector (the 4 pin connect that is in the shape of a square). If it doesn't then you will need a new PSU.
 
its a 20 pin motherboard ... i think ill go buy a new powersupply, because im doubting if its enough and that could be the cause.
